    I recently purchased Simplify3D and I am having issues getting it to print correctly. It will not engage my z-axis stepper motors during a print. I have full control of the printer during non-printing periods, but when it starts to print it stays at the z-home position while proceeding onward with the print and eventually jams the extruder. There is no resistance when I try and turn the threaded rod during a print. It seems like there is simply no command being sent during the print to even engage the motors. I inserted the (M17; Enable power to Stepper Motors) command to the starting G-code script and there was still no movement.

    I tried the prints with MC and it worked fine until it disconnected and stalled like it normally does. Also, during the MC test; the threaded rods were fully engaged with heavy resistance. Any help would be great!
